Corporate Apparel

The term itself just sounds intimidating, doesn't it? It visualizes powerful executives, large offices and tall buildings. In real sense corporate apparel is simply portraying the positive impression at every level of business. Imagine a typical day without the corporate attire. In any profession the person's looks plays a large part in portraying the initial impression about them. It goes far beyond one's clothing and it includes the general grooming and the body language of a person. The first impression formed by a person says a lot about their personality, intelligence and diligence.

In the business and work environment it would definitely pay for one to find out how people dress and the culture that is maintained at any level. When going for job interviews it is advisable to dress a bit more formal than the other business days.Dressing for work does not mean leaving one’s personal style behind. Your major goal should be to project the professional and competent image regardless of the kind of employment or one’s career path.

 The fit of fashion, colors and styles says a lot about an individual’s capability to do a job. A person who is more concerned about their job will be more concerned with looking professional than looking cute and trendy and you will realize that more distracting pieces of clothing and jewelry.
